Bobby Abrom Manasco Bobby Manasco, 75 passed away Thursday, February 9, 2012 at his residence. Visitation for Mr. Manasco will be Saturday, February 11, 2012 from 6 – 8 PM at Lowndes Funeral Home, Columbus, MS. Funeral Services will be Sunday, February 12, 2012 at 2 PM in the Lowndes Funeral Home Chapel with Mr. Simon Harris officiating. Mr. Manasco was born July 31, 1936 to the late Ollie Abrom and Rhoda Edwards Manasco in Caledonia, MS, he lived in the Columbus/Lowndes County area his entire life. Mr. Manasco was a veteran of the United States Navy. He retired from Gulf States, Starkville, MS as maintenance supervisor in 1999. Mr. Manasco was a member of East Columbus Church of Christ, Columbus, MS, he enjoyed people and drinking coffee at various coffee clubs in Columbus, MS. In addition to his parents, Mr. Manasco was preceded in death by his sisters - Geneva Evans, Peal Langford and his brother – Mac Rector. Mr. Manasco is survived by his wife – Joyce Manasco, Columbus, MS, Daughter – Susan (Chris) Robison, Caledonia, MS , Sons – Mike (Shelly) Manasco, Tempe, AZ and Scott (Janet) Manasco, West Point, MS, Grandchildren – Amy (Frankie) Mitchell, Stacy (Kyle Rinehart) Robison, Megan Manasco, Kate Manasco, Aiden Manasco, Great-grandchild – Riley Mitchell. Honorary Pallbearers will be Members of East Columbus Church of Christ and Members of Lake Norris Fishing Club.
